Why Investors Are Betting on East Africa's Invisible Technology


Most Kenyan banks and SACCOs run on software built by a company almost no one outside finance has heard of. Craft Silicon has quietly powered core banking systems for more than 250 financial institutions across 30-plus countries since 2000, processing billions of dollars a year, without ever becoming a household name. That's the pattern worth paying attention to: the companies doing the heaviest lifting in East Africa's digital economy are often the ones nobody's talking about.

Call it invisible technology: the software, infrastructure, and platforms that power other businesses rather than sell directly to consumers. Nobody posts about switching core banking providers. Nobody screenshots a cloud migration. But increasingly, this is where the money is going. The next generation of East African tech winners may not be consumer brands at all. They may be the companies building the infrastructure every other business quietly depends on.

How East African Tech Moved From Consumers to Infrastructure

The region's first wave of tech success was built on reaching millions of individual people at once: mobile payments, e-commerce, ride-hailing. That wave proved East Africa could build technology businesses at real scale, and it pulled in the venture capital that funded everything that came after.

The second wave looks different. Instead of chasing consumer attention, a growing set of companies are chasing enterprise budgets, the recurring line-item spending of banks, retailers, telcos, and governments that need software to actually run their operations. Investors are increasingly backing companies that enable other businesses to operate more efficiently, rather than businesses that compete for a slice of one consumer's daily attention.

The Five Layers of Infrastructure Investors Are Watching

Financial software. Craft Silicon, the Nairobi-headquartered software house founded in 2000, builds core banking, microfinance, and payments systems used by more than 250 financial institutions across Africa and Asia. Kwara, a much younger Nairobi and Berlin-based startup founded in 2018, is doing something similar for a specific niche: turning Kenya's savings and credit cooperatives (SACCOs), which collectively hold hundreds of billions of shillings in member deposits, into modern digital banks. Neither company is a bank. Both are the technology layer banks and SACCOs quietly run on.

Cloud and data infrastructure. Every AI model, banking app, and SaaS platform needs somewhere to run. Angani, founded in Nairobi in 2014, was East Africa's first public cloud services provider and now operates multiple data centres in Kenya with points of presence in Rwanda, Uganda, and Tanzania, hosting workloads for businesses that would otherwise have to build and maintain their own servers. East Africa's broader data centre market is forecast to grow from roughly $1.6 billion in 2025 to about $2.27 billion by 2030, a build-out we covered in Why Data Centres Are Becoming East Africa's Next Big Infrastructure.

Cybersecurity. As more of the above moves online, someone has to defend it. Fanan Limited, an ISO 27001-certified cybersecurity firm operating across Kenya, Uganda, Tanzania, and Rwanda, runs managed security operations centres and penetration testing for clients ranging from SMEs to government agencies, treating security not as an add-on but as its own category of infrastructure, a shift we explored in The East African Cybersecurity Companies Building the Region's Digital Trust Infrastructure.

AI infrastructure. AI adoption depends on more than clever applications, it depends on the unglamorous, human work of preparing the data that trains a model in the first place. Sama, founded in San Francisco but built largely on the ground in Nairobi and Kampala, is the largest AI data annotation employer in East Africa, with thousands of staff labelling the images, video, and text that Fortune 500 companies use to train machine learning systems for everything from autonomous vehicles to retail. Almost nobody outside the industry has heard of it. Almost every major AI company has quietly relied on work like it, a theme we picked up in How AI Is Transforming Banking Across East Africa.

Payments and settlement rails. Money still has to move between all of the above, often across borders, currencies, and mobile money systems that don't naturally talk to each other. That plumbing, largely invisible to the customer tapping "send," is what determines whether a digital economy actually functions at national scale.

Why This Kind of Business Appeals to Investors

Infrastructure companies tend to share a few financial traits that consumer apps rarely offer.

They generate recurring revenue: enterprise customers pay through subscriptions and long-term service contracts rather than one-off purchases, which makes future income far easier to predict. They come with high switching costs: once a core banking system, cloud platform, or SOC contract is embedded in how a business operates, ripping it out is expensive and disruptive, so customers tend to stay for years, sometimes decades, as Craft Silicon's client relationships show. They grow alongside the economy itself, since every business that digitises needs more cloud capacity, more security, more clean training data, demand doesn't depend on any single company's marketing budget. And they can create enormous value without chasing millions of individual users: a few hundred enterprise or government contracts can be worth more, over time, than a consumer app with a far bigger download count.

Four Signals Worth Tracking

Infrastructure over consumer apps. Capital is increasingly flowing toward businesses that enable other businesses, not just ones that reach the most individual users.

Regional scalability. The strongest infrastructure companies, Craft Silicon and Angani among them, are built to operate across multiple African markets rather than expanding into a second country as an afterthought.

Regulatory tailwinds. Digital identity, cloud adoption, cybersecurity, and payments are increasingly benefiting from supportive government policy and public investment, a dynamic we mapped out in How East African Governments Are Becoming Technology Customers.

AI is accelerating demand for everything underneath it. Every new AI deployment increases demand for cloud capacity, cybersecurity, clean training data, and enterprise software, even when the AI product itself gets all the attention.

Where This Gets Hard

None of this is an easy business to build.

Enterprise sales cycles are long, sometimes stretching well over a year from first meeting to signed contract, which tests the patience of a startup's runway. These businesses are often capital-intensive, requiring real infrastructure investment before revenue follows. Regulatory complexity varies by market and by sector, particularly for anything touching payments or data. Talent is scarce: the AI engineers, cybersecurity specialists, and cloud architects this wave depends on are in short supply across the region, a gap we explored in The Tech Jobs AI Is Least Likely to Replace in East Africa. And winning enterprise or government customers requires a different kind of trust-building than winning consumers, one built on compliance, references, and track record rather than a viral marketing moment.
